Catching Up with Music Theory by Taylin - December 2024 Scholarship Essay
When I got to PBA, I decided to bump myself down from Music Theory 1 to Intro to Music Theory because I personally knew that I did not have all my theory bases covered. While I was glad I took the intro class, it caused me to have to go a whole year without taking theory and aural skills since the classes I needed were not being offered those two semesters. When I was able to take theory and aural skills again, it was with a different teacher since my original teacher had left. I was the only junior in that class with everyone else being sophomores. I felt very lonely and awkward. Not only that, but they had left off on content my original theory class never went over. Therefore, I had to catch up on a lot of new things and continue to learn other new things at the same time. At one point my grade slowly started dropping because while I did well with homework, my exam grades did not reflect that. I overcame this by doing three things: Prayer, studying, and communication.
My faith plays an important part in my academics. Praying actually brings me a lot of peace and comfort, so I would pray before each exam. I also had to separate time to study a little more extra for theory class. So I would pray before each study session and homework session. Eventually, I had to communicate with my new teacher about my struggle. He was kind enough to offer me extra help and in class he would make sure to stop and ask if I was okay with what was being taught. It was very considerate of him and I knew it was also helping out my classmates as well. I eventually finished those classes with an A.
